I’m a novice when it comes to this subject, so when I looked into this product initially I was concerned that the content may be tough to follow; I was mistaken! All of the information contained in the product is written in a clear, understandable fashion. First off, Energy 2 Green is comprised of a total of 4 E-books and 2 Bonus guides. The 4 e-books are broken down into 2 guides that teach you how to build your own solar panel and 2 guides on how to construct a wind turbine generator. Each of the two subjects has over 120 pages of information dedicated to it; more than enough let me tell you! The 2 bonus guides are just cherries on top. There is 1 bonus guide dedicated to solar power systems and the other to wind power systems. I felt the bonus guides themselves could be sold separately for the cost of the product. They are packed full of educational material.
Another valuable part of the product that helped me understand the process of building a solar panel were the 4 videos that were also included. I was initially a bit concerned about the videos using subtitles instead of being verbally narrated to explain each step. After the first few sections, I actually found the subtitles to be helpful because it forced me to really concentrate on each of the construction steps. By the end of the videos, I felt the subtitles were very little, if any hindrance to my understanding.
